Changing a lost motorist's license in Belgium includes a series of actions that may vary a little depending on the region. Below is a generalized summary of the process.
Step 1: Report the Loss
File a Police Report: If your license was taken, the primary step is to report the theft to the regional police station. Ask for a copy of the police report, as you may require to present it when looking for Aanvraag Belgisch Rijbewijs a replacement.
Self-Declaration: If the license was simply lost, you might need to offer a self-declaration regarding the loss. This document validates that the license is completely lost and not Rijbewijs In België your belongings.
Step 2: Gather Necessary Documents
To apply for a replacement, collect the following documents:

Go to the proper local authority office accountable for driving licenses in your location. This might be a commune or town hall. Bring all gathered documents and fill in any extra kinds if needed.
Step 4: Pay the Replacement Fee
The replacement cost varies by region and might likewise depend upon whether you need a short-lived license. Below is a general summary of the costs:

After submission, you will typically get a short-term license on the spot while your official replacement is processed. The official license will be mailed to your registered address within a few weeks.
Extra Tips for a Smooth Process
Check Local Requirements: Contact your regional authority ahead of time to validate the required documents and charges as they can vary significantly.
Protect Your ID: Keep a copy of your lost license and other essential documents to speed up the replacement procedure.
Track Your Application: Keep the invoice and any referral numbers supplied to you, as this can assist in tracking the status of your replacement license.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)1. The length of time does it take to receive my new motorist's license?
The processing time for a replacement can differ. Normally, the temporary license is released right away, while the irreversible replacement might take anywhere from 2 to 6 weeks.
2. Can I drive with a momentary license?
Yes, you can drive with the momentary license while awaiting your brand-new one.
3. What if I find my lost license after getting a replacement?
If you find your lost license after requesting a replacement, you are needed to return it to your regional authority right away and notify them of the situation.
4. Exists a way to get an emergency situation replacement?
In many cases, local authorities might provide an expedited service for an additional cost. It's best to ask about this option at your local authority.
5. Can I replace my motorist's license if I am not currently in Belgium?
If you are briefly outdoors Belgium, call the nearby Belgian embassy or consulate for assistance on how to obtain a replacement license.
